AI tools Although they have developed quite a bit recently, they sometimes come with unexpected problems. Finally, Google’s AI-powered search found itself struggling to solve even simple math questions. WashingtonPost In the study by , artificial intelligence gave incorrect results.
In previous statements by Google SGE (Search Generative Experience) It was announced that the said system was developed from the original version. Apparently these improvements were not enough. In the experiment conducted SGEwhen asked about Meta CEO Mark Zuckerberg’s net worth “He makes $46.24 an hour, $96,169 a year. That works out to $8,014 per month, $1,849 per week, and to $230.6 million per day It corresponds.” he said. Numbers never matchlike it An interesting result emerges, such as daily revenues reaching millions of dollars.
This function paid subscriptions It will also be used for. People will also want to get accurate transaction results after paying money. Especially when it comes to math, if these numbers are incorrect, they can lead to very misinformation emerging and spreading.
